halchin
Navajo
Etymology
ho- (“space, area, things”) + -Ø- (ni-modal 3rd person subject prefix) + -l- (classifier) + -chin (neuter imperfective stem of root -CHĄ́Ą́ʼ, “to smell”).
Usage notes
This is a neuter verb that uses only the imperfective mode.
Conjugation
Paradigm: Neuter imperfective (ni)
IMPERFECTIVE | singular | duoplural | plural |
---|---|---|---|
1st person | honishchin | honiilchin | dahoniilchin |
2nd person | honílchin | honołchin | dahonołchin |
3rd person | halchin | dahalchin | |
4th person | hojílchin | dahojílchin |
